s = int(input())
t = int(input())
A = int(input())
if (s > A) and (t > 12):
print("YES")
else:
print("NO")
Программу запускали 7 раз, при этом переменные s и t вводились парой чисел: (13, 12); (11, 14); (12, 13); (10, 11); (14, 10); (13, 10); (12, 14).
Укажите наибольшее целое значение параметра А, при котором для указанных входных данных программа напечатает NO четыре раза.
Для решения этой задачи разберёмся, как работает предложенный код. Код принимает три входных параметра: `s`, `t` и `A`. Затем он проверяет два условия с помощью оператора `if`:
1. `s > A`
2. `t > 12`
Если оба условия выполняются, программа выводит "YES"; если нет — "NO".
Теперь необходимо проанализировать входные данные, чтобы увидеть, при каких значениях A программа будет выводить "NO" четыре раза. Мы имеем семь пар входных данных:
1. (13, 12)
2. (11, 14)
3. (12, 13)
4. (10, 11)
5. (14, 10)
6. (13, 10)
7. (12, 14)
Давайте проверим, при каких значениях A каждое из пар (s, t) приведет к выводу "NO".
Для вывода "NO" хотя бы одно из условий должно быть ложным:
1. `s <= A` или `t <= 12`
Теперь оценим каждую пару на задания условиях.
- **(13, 12)**:
- `s > A`: 13 > A (при A < 13)
- `t > 12`: 12 (ложно, если A ≥ 12)
- "NO", если A ≥ 13.
- **(11, 14)**:
- `s > A`: 11 > A (при A < 11)
- `t > 12`: 14 (истинно)
- "NO", если A ≥ 11.
- **(12, 13)**:
- `s > A`: 12 > A (при A < 12)
- `t > 12`: 13 (истинно)
- "NO", если A ≥ 12.
- **(10, 11)**:
- `s > A`: 10 > A (при A < 10)
- `t > 12`: 11 (ложно, если A ≥ 12)
- "NO", если A ≥ 12.
- **(14, 10)**:
- `s > A`: 14 (всегда верно)
- `t > 12`: 10 (ложно, если A ≥ 12)
- "NO", если A ≥ 12.
- **(13, 10)**:
- `s > A`: 13 (всегда верно)
- `t > 12`: 10 (ложно, если A ≥ 12)
- "NO", если A ≥ 12.
- **(12, 14)**:
- `s > A`: 12 > A (при A < 12)
- `t > 12`: 14 (истинно)
- "NO", если A ≥ 12.
Теперь подытожим условия для каждой пары, чтобы найти значение A, которое дает 4 "NO":
- (13, 12): "NO" при A ≥ 13
- (11, 14): "NO" при A ≥ 11
- (12, 13): "NO" при A ≥ 12
- (10, 11): "NO" при A ≥ 12
- (14, 10): "NO" при A ≥ 12
- (13, 10): "NO" при A ≥ 12
- (12, 14): "NO" при A < 12
Таким образом, значение A должно быть таким, чтобы определенные условия работали. С учетом того, что "NO" должно выводиться в 4 случаях, оптимальное значение A — 12.
Если A = 12:
- Пары (13, 12), (12, 13), (10, 11), (14, 10), и (13, 10) приведут к "NO".
- Пары (11, 14) и (12, 14) будут "YES".
Однако, при A = 11 мы имеем:
- Пары (13, 12), (12, 13), (10, 11), а также (14, 10), (13, 10) все будут возвращать "NO", тогда как (11, 14) и (12, 14) будут возвращать "YES".
Таким образом, максимальное значение — A = 11 при котором 4 пары возвращают "NO":
**Ответ: 11**.